Output f5d5a6301d3ee160f53a1facbf87c52ab61c21e8411252b6473cf5d527363ba3:2

value
1121421804
script pubkey
OP_0 OP_PUSHBYTES_20 95d2e39436dfcd38236a46479ddf19068c60a74f
address
tb1qjhfw89pkmlxnsgm2geremhceq6xxpf60lcayan
transaction
f5d5a6301d3ee160f53a1facbf87c52ab61c21e8411252b6473cf5d527363ba3
confirmations
33866
spent
true